HVAC Leak Water Removal Cost In Willoughby Spit, VA
The cost of HVAC leak water remov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Willoughby Spit, VA. Our estimates are based on a thorough assessment of the damage and a customized plan to restore your home. Prices vary. But we’ll give you an honest estimate. So you can plan ahead.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of water damage. |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ials needed, and complexity of repairs. |
| M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and level of contamination. |
| Dehumidification and drying |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and level of humidity. |
| Equipment rental and labor |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and level of labor required. |
| Inspection and testing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of testing needed, and level of expertise required. |
